#8f2249 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8f2249 is composed of 56.1% red, 13.3%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.2% magenta, 49%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 338.5 degrees, a saturation of 61.6% and a lightness of 34.7%. #8f2249 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4492 with #1f0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#8f2249 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8f2249 has RGB values of R:143, G:34,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.49,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9380425.
